Abstract

With the popularization of video detection and recognition systems and the advancement of video image processing technology, the application research of intelligent transportation systems based on computer vision technology has received more and more attention. It comprehensively utilizes image processing, pattern recognition, artificial intelligence and other technologies. It also involves processing and analyzing the video image sequence collected by the detection system, intelligently understanding the video content and making processing, and dealing with various problems such as accident information judgment, pedestrian and vehicle classification, traffic flow parameter detection, and moving target tracking. It promotes intelligent transportation systems to be more intelligent and practical, and provides comprehensive, real-time traffic status information for traffic management and control. Therefore, the research on the method of traffic information detection based on computer vision has important theoretical and practical significance. The detection and recognition of video targets is an important research direction in the field of intelligent transportation and computer vision. However, due to the background complexity, illumination changes, target occlusion and other factors in the detection and recognition environment, the application still faces many difficulties, and the robustness and accuracy of detection and recognition need to be further improved. In this paper, several key problems in video object detection and recognition are studied, including accurate segmentation of target and background, shadow in complex scenes; accurate classification of extracted foreground targets; and target recognition in complex background. In response to these problems, this paper proposes a corresponding solution.
